Dynamic Optimization

Course content

Systematic extension of the basic knowledge acquired in the bachelor's degree programme in mathematics and expansion of knowledge and expertise in additional areas of mathematics

  • Gain an understanding of the complex links between the different areas of applied and pure mathematics
  • Studying theories and mastering their complex methods and studying in-depth mathematical applications also through project-type examples
  • Introduction to the problems of optimal control, parameter estimation, optimal experimental design and model discrimination
  • Recognizing and mastering different fundamental approaches in the field of optimal control
  • In depth acquaintance of ways to analyze and interpret numerical algorithms and increase their efficiency, exemplified for optimal control
